Not sure, but you may be able to get ex battery hens in France too. Try googling poulets de sauvetage You just need a small garden shed, a bit of chicken wire to ensure their safety from predators on the ground, a big bowl of water and a fairly flat dish for food, a plastic or vinyl floor in the shed (makes it easy to clean out), and a nesting box(an old drawer with straw in it) some straw on the floor and a bit of wood half way up to perch on - or an old free standing shelf unit which is what mine have.
